body{overflow-x:hidden;}a:link, a:visited{text-decoration:none;}a:hover, a:active{text-decoration:underline;}.icon{background-image:url(/tmpl_images/sprite.png)}#container{position:relative;z-index:20;}.center{width:980px;}#containerTopFixed{position:relative; width:980px; margin:0 auto; z-index:888;}#containerTopFixed .overlay:first-child{background-color:transparent !important; bottom:-102px; top:auto; left:50%; margin-left:-523px; width:1095px; height:125px; background-image:url(/tmpl_images/bgFixedMenu.png); background-repeat:no-repeat;}#containerTopFixed .center{background:#fff !important; padding:0 10px; width:960px;}.nav_posTopCenter_horizontal #containerTop, .search_posTopCenter #containerTop{z-index:999;}.nav_posTopRight_horizontal #containerTop{z-index:11111;}#containerTop .center{margin:45px auto;}#containerTop .center{background:none!important;}#bannerBarBottom .overlay, #bannerBarTop .overlay{background:transparent !important;}.nav_posBannerTopLeft_horizontal #bannerBarTop, .nav_posBannerBottomLeft_horizontal #bannerBarBottom{border-bottom-width:1px; border-top-width:1px; border-style:solid; width:980px; margin:0 auto;}.nav_posBannerTopLeft_horizontal #bannerBarTop{z-index:999;}#containerBanner{margin-bottom:45px;}.nav_posBannerTopLeft_horizontal #containerBanner{margin-top:45px;}#headergraphic{position:relative;}.headerExtra1, .headerExtra2{width:1183px; height:219px; background-image:url(/tmpl_images/bgBannerTop.png); background-repeat:no-repeat; position:absolute; top:-90px; left:-177px; z-index:888;}.headerExtra2{width:1114px; height:203px; background-image:url(/tmpl_images/bgBannerBottom.png); top:auto; bottom:-38px; left:-64px;}#contentBox .center:before, #contentBox .center:after, footer .center:before{content:""; position:absolute; top:65px; left:-190px; width:349px; height:282px; background-image:url(/tmpl_images/scLeft.png); background-repeat:no-repeat; visibility:visible;}#contentBox .center:after{background-image:url(/tmpl_images/scRight.png); left:auto; right:-311px; top:670px; width:381px; height:307px; z-index:-1;}#contentBox .center{background:#fff !important;}#mainContent{width:700px; padding:52px 20px 20px;}#home_page #mainContent, .nav_posSidebarRight_vertical #mainSidebar, .nav_posSidebarLeft_vertical #mainSidebar, .search_posSidebarRight #mainSidebar{padding-top:20px;}#mainSidebar{width:194px; padding:40px 20px 20px 25px; margin-top:21px; border-left-width:1px; border-style:solid; border-color:#e1e1e1;}#home_page #mainSidebar{margin-top:0;}.sidebar_leftSidebar #mainSidebar{border-right-width:1px; border-left-width:0px;}footer{background:transparent !important; clear:both;}footer .center:before{background-image:url(/tmpl_images/scBottom.png); top:-183px; left:-276px; width:509px; height: 273px; z-index:-1;} footer .center{border-top:1px solid; padding:20px 0 15px; } footer{border:0px;}#logoTitle a#logo{margin-right:20px;}#logoTitle #containerTitle .siteTitle{margin-bottom:15px;}#logoTitle #containerTitle .siteTitle a:link{text-shadow: 0 0 10px rgba(0,0,0,0.3);}#logoTitle #containerTitle .siteTitle a:hover{text-decoration:none;}#navMain ul li a:link, #navMain ul li a:visited{padding:19px 10px 19px 10px; opacity:1;filter: alpha(opacity=100);-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=100)";}#navMain ul li a:hover{text-decoration:none;}#navMain ul li.active a:link, #navMain ul li.active a:visited{padding-right:24px!important;}#navMain ul li.active a span.triangle{right: 10px;}#navMain ul li.selected a{background:url(/tmpl_images/bgMenuSelected.png) no-repeat center center; text-shadow:0px 1px 0px rgba(0, 0, 0, 1);}#navMain ul.secondLevel li, #navMain ul.thirdLevel li{margin:0 !important;}.nav_posTopRight_horizontal #navMain ul li, .nav_posTopCenter_horizontal #navMain ul li{margin-left:5px; margin-bottom:5px;}.nav_posTopRight_horizontal #navMain ul li:first-child, .nav_posTopCenter_horizontal #navMain ul li:first-child{margin-left:0;}#navMain.horizontal ul.firstLevel li:first-child a{border-left:0;}#navMain.horizontal ul.firstLevel li:last-child a{border-right:0;}#navMain.posTopFixedLeft ul.firstLevel > li a, #navMain.posTopFixedRight ul.firstLevel > li a, #navMain.posBannerTopLeft ul.firstLevel > li a, #navMain.posBannerBottomLeft ul.firstLevel > li a{border-color:transparent;}#navMain.posTopRight ul li a, #navMain.posTopCenter ul li a{padding:12px; border-radius:5px; text-decoration:none;}#navMain.posBannerTopLeft ul.firstLevel li:first-child a{border-radius:10px 0 0 0;}#navMain.posTopRight{margin-top:20px;}#navMain.posTopCenter{margin-top:30px;}#navMain.posTopRight ul.firstLevel li a,#navMain.posTopCenter ul.firstLevel li a{border:0;}#navMain.horizontal.posTopFixedLeft ul.firstLevel li a, #navMain.horizontal.posTopFixedRight ul.firstLevel li a{background-color:transparent !important; border:none;}#navMain.horizontal.posTopFixedLeft ul.firstLevel li.selected a, #navMain.horizontal.posTopFixedLeft ul.firstLevel li a:hover, #navMain.horizontal.posTopFixedRight ul.firstLevel li.selected a, #navMain.horizontal.posTopFixedRight ul.firstLevel li a:hover{color:#2E2E2E; text-shadow:none;}#navMain.posBannerBottomLeft ul li a:link, #navMain.posBannerBottomLeft ul li a:visited, #navMain.posBannerTopLeft ul li a:link, #navMain.posBannerTopLeft ul li a:visited{background:url(/tmpl_images/separatorMenu.png) no-repeat center right}#navMain.vertical{margin-bottom:30px;}#navMain.vertical ul.firstLevel li:first-child a{border-top:0;}#navMain.vertical ul.firstLevel li:last-child a{border-bottom:0;}#navMain.vertical ul li a{margin-bottom:1px; padding:15px 10px;}#navMain.vertical ul li.selected a{background-position:left center;}#search form .overlay{display:none;}#search .icon{background-position:0 0; right:-10px; top:-10px;}#search input.searchstyle{width:115px;height:32px;line-height:32px; padding:0 30px 0 5px; font-size:14px; background:url(/tmpl_images/bgSearchBlack.png) no-repeat bottom center;}#search input.submitstyle{border:0;position:absolute;width:25px;height:25px;*text-transform:uppercase; text-indent:-999px;z-index:5;top:4px;right:3px;background-color:transparent; cursor:pointer;}#search.posSidebarLeft, #search.posSidebarRight{margin:0 auto 40px; width:160px;}#search.posTopFixedLeft, #search.posTopFixedRight{margin:8px 0;}#search.posTopFixedRight{margin-right:10px;}#search.posTopCenter{margin-top:30px;}#home_page.nav_posBannerTopLeft_horizontal #search.posTopRight, #home_page.nav_posBannerBottomLeft_horizontal #search.posTopRight, #home_page.nav_posSidebarLeft_vertical #search.posTopRight, #home_page.nav_posSidebarRight_vertical #search.posTopRight{right:60px;}#search.posTopRight{position:absolute; top:50%; right:0; margin-top:-16px;}#search.posTopRight .overlay, #search.posTopCenter .overlay{background-color:transparent !important; box-shadow:none;}#search.posTopRight .icon, #search.posTopCenter .icon{background-position:-50px 0;}#search.posTopRight input.searchstyle, #search.posTopCenter input.searchstyle{background:url(/tmpl_images/bgSearchWhite.png) no-repeat bottom center; color:#fff !important;}#selectLanguage.posTopFixedLeft, #selectLanguage.posTopFixedRight{margin-top:8px; margin-bottom:8px;}#selectLanguage.posTopFixedLeft{margin-left:10px;} #selectLanguage.posTopFixedRight{margin-right:10px;}#selectLanguage.posTopCenter{top:12px; margin-right:5px; *top:4px; *left:-5px;}#selectLanguage.posTopRight{position:absolute; top:50%; right:0; margin-top:-17px;}#dynamic_content_page #path{top:-92px;}#path{margin:0 0 25px; padding:5px 20px; position:absolute; top:-52px; width:940px;}.sidebar_leftSidebar #path{left:-260px;}.sidebar_rightSidebar #path{left:-20px;}h1.pagename, h3.pagename{margin-bottom:25px;}.print-deco01{background:url(/tmpl_images/bgPrint.png) no-repeat 43px 30px}#print{top:-60px;}#print a{display:block; height:25px; background:url(/tmpl_images/sprite.png) no-repeat scroll -5px -105px; text-transform:capitalize; padding-top:15px; text-indent:43px;}#mainContent #box_news_hp .innerbox_news_hp_central{border-bottom:1px solid;margin-bottom:20px;}#mainContent #box_news_hp h4{margin-bottom:20px;}#mainContent #box_news_hp .news_item{margin-bottom:10px;}#red_box_container, #dinamic_red_box_container{padding-bottom:5px;}.red_box_frame .red_box_frame-deco01{border-bottom:1px solid; margin-bottom:20px; padding-bottom:20px;}.red_box_frame:last-child .red_box_frame-deco01{margin-bottom:0;}.red_box_frame.small-red-box{width:340px;margin-right:20px;} body#dynamic_content_page .red_box_frame, body#risultato_ricerca .red_box_frame{overflow:visible}.red_box h3{margin-bottom:20px;}.red_box .date_comments{}.red_box img, .wide_image{border-width:5px; border-style:solid; margin:0 0 15px 0; box-shadow:5px 5px 0 #D9D9D9}.red_box img.left_image{margin:0 15px 15px 0;}.box-attach img{margin-top:-8px; margin-right:7px;}#nav_dinamic{margin-bottom:20px;}#nav_dinamic a, #nav_dinamic-bottom a, #nav_dinamic span.page_sel, #nav_dinamic-bottom span.page_sel{padding:10px; display:inline-block;}ul#navigation{width:100% !important; position:relative; z-index:1; margin:40px 0 10px !important;}#photogallery_page ul#navigation{width:684px !important;}ul#navigation .nav_arrow, ul#navigation a.prev_page_int span, ul#navigation .next_page_int span{padding:5px;}ul#navigation li{list-style:none;}ul#navigation li a, #nav_dinamic a:hover, #nav_dinamic-bottom a:hover, ul#navigation li a:hover{text-decoration:none;}.copertina-album img{box-shadow:none !important;}.button-slideshow{top:0px;}#box_contact{line-height: 170%;}.span-label-radio, .custom-radio{float:none !important; margin-right:5px;}.custom-checkbox{margin-right:5px;}.submit_send{padding:10px; width:80px !important; cursor:pointer; background:#919191; color:#fff; border:none;}.red_box .figure img, .containerFeatured #thumbCommerce img{box-shadow:none !important;}#share_box{margin:0 0 20px 0 !important;}#home_page #share_box{margin-bottom: 0px!important;}#facebook_box,#twitter_box,#flickr_box{margin-left: 10px!important;}#blueBoxContainer .blue_box_external_bg{border:0px solid;position:relative;}#blueBoxContainer .blue_box_external_bg-deco03>div:last-child{margin-bottom:0;}#box_news_hp, .sidebar-albums, #sitofono_button, .blue_box, #social_container{margin:0px 0 40px !important; min-height:100px; height:auto !important; height:100px;}.blue_box.appSidebar p:first-child{margin-top:0;}#sitofono_button{min-height:inherit;}.innerbox_news_hp{margin-bottom:20px;}.innerbox_news_hp:last-child{margin-bottom:0;}#mainSidebar h4{transform:rotate(-3deg); margin-bottom:26px; position:relative; z-index:1;}.blue_box img, .sidebar-albums li a b img {border:5px solid; box-shadow:5px 5px 0px rgba(217, 217, 217, 1);}.sidebar-albums li a b{background:none!important;}#box_news_hp .news_item, #box_news_hp h4 + div, .sidebar-albums li, .blue_box a, .blue_box img, .blue_box p, .appContainer{margin-top:10px; padding-top:5px; padding-left:5px; position:relative; z-index:1;}.blue_box a img{padding:0; margin:0;}.blue_box h4+a{margin:0;}#box_news_hp, .sidebar-albums, .blue_box{position:relative;}#box_news_hp h4:before, .sidebar-albums h4:before, .blue_box h4:before{content:""; width:242px; height:120px; position:absolute; top:-27px; left:-18px; background:url(/tmpl_images/bgSidebarBoxBig.png) no-repeat; z-index:-1;}#mainSidebar #box_news_hp .innerbox_news_hp{margin-bottom:40px;}#mainSidebar #box_news_hp a, #mainSidebar #box_news_hp a:hover {display:block;}.sidebar-albums li{padding:0 !important;}.sidebar-albums li a span{left:5px !important; bottom:10px !important;}.blue_box .bluebox_img {border:none!important;padding:0!important;}footer a:link, footer a:visited{border:0px solid;}footer ul#viral{text-align:center;margin-bottom:20px;font-size:1em;}footer ul#viral li{margin:0 15px 0 0;line-height:25px;padding-left:35px}footer ul#viral li.viralDate{padding-left:40px;}footer ul#viral li.viralPageview{padding-left:33px;}footer ul#viral li.last{margin-right:0}footer ul#viral li span.icon{left:-12px;top:-13px;}footer ul#viral li.viralDate span.icon{background-position:-149px -49px;}footer ul#viral li.viralPageview span.icon{background-position:-100px -50px;}footer ul#viral li.viralBookmark span.icon{background-position:0 -50px;}footer ul#viral li.viralSendFriend span.icon{background-position:-50px -50px;}footer span.copyright{text-align:center;font-size:0.8em;}#home_special footer{padding:0 !important; border-style:solid; border-top-width:1px;}@media only screen and (max-height:800px){#home_special.hs_menuVertical.hs_03 footer, #home_special.hs_menuVertical.hs_04 footer, #home_special.twoBox footer, #home_special.threeBox footer{position:static;}}#home_special footer .center{width:100%;}#home_special footer .center:before{display:none;}#containerMenu #selectLanguage.posTopRight{margin-top:-17px;}.hs_menuVertical #containerMenu #selectLanguage{position:relative;}.hs_08 #containerMenu, .hs_01.twoBox #containerMenu{background-color:transparent !important; position:relative;}.hs_08 #containerMenu .center:before, .hs_01.twoBox #containerMenu .center:before{content:""; position:absolute; bottom:-105px; top:auto; left:50%; margin-left:-523px; width:1095px; height:125px; background-image:url(/tmpl_images/bgFixedMenu.png); background-repeat:no-repeat; visibility:visible;}#home_special.hs_01 #selectLanguage.posTopRight, #home_special.hs_08 #selectLanguage.posTopRight{right:20px;}.hs_07 #navMain.vertical ul li.selected a, .hs_04 #navMain.vertical ul li.selected a{background-position:15px center}